Why Resolving Financial Health Is Secret to Workforce Stability
The American Psychological Organization (APA) has consistently reported that monetary issues are among the leading resources of stress and anxiety for grownups in the U.S. Over 70% of participants in a recent APA study mentioned that money worries are a considerable stress factor in their lives. This tension has straight ramifications for office efficiency: staff members sidetracked by personal financial problems are most likely to experience exhaustion, miss deadlines, and seek brand-new job chances with greater wages to cover their financial obligations.
Economically stressed employees are also extra vulnerable to health issues, such as anxiousness, anxiety, and hypertension, which contribute to enhanced healthcare prices for companies. Addressing this issue early, with detailed financial obligation resolution solutions, can mitigate these risks and cultivate a healthier, a lot more stable workforce.
